Advanced Sensors - Produced Water Analysers

UK based Advanced Sensors Ltd have developed a range of maintenance-free oil in water monitors that can be connected via the Internet. The OIW EX 1000 series of oil-in-water analysers offer a number of market firsts including;

  • Maintenance free self-cleaning
  • Remote connectivity
  • Enhanced measuring range from ppb up to 10,000ppm
  • Online UV full scan spectrometer

The OSPAR 40mg/l discharge limit in place in the North Sea requires online produced water analysers to correlate with the defined reference method of GC-FID. To date, a number of technologies have been used to correlate an online analyser method with the defined lab method. Advanced Sensors Ltd's results prove a consistent correlation over a rolling period of +/-1ppm.

OIW EX 1000 SERIES OF OIL-IN-WATER ANALYSERS

The OIW EX analyser uses patented ultrasonic self-cleaning technology. This removes the need for maintenance, and provides a consistent, reliable measurement with ±1% accuracy. The large robust measuring chamber removes the need for any flow control, mechanical mixers, chemical additives or human intervention.

Advanced Sensors managing director, Khalid Thabeth, is proud that a major advancement in the EX1000 is that it is maintenance free. "Oil in water monitors have historically been plagued with faulting and contamination of the measuring sensors, the OIW EX1000 incorporates an ultrasonic cleaning technique that ensures the sensors remain clean and measurement accuracy does not deteriorate," said Thabeth.

REMOTE OIL IN WATER MONITORING

When OIW-EX 1000 units are networked to the Internet or intranet, remote monitoring, control and diagnostics are possible from anywhere in the world. The remote access to OIW-EX 1000 systems gives significant mobilization savings and ease of ownership. Combined with 24hour support from Advanced Sensors, all clients benefit from a 100% success rate.

"The unit is based on the Windows XP operating system and is supplied ready to connect to a companied network, this level of network connectivity allows the remote monitoring of the instrument and the remote diagnostics of the instrument by Advanced Sensors," said Thabeth.

The OIW-EX 1000 has an extremely dynamic operating range, detecting oil concentrations from lowppb to 10,000ppm. Instruments can be placed at multiple points through the process and monitored from one location. Thus enabling proactive intervention and process optimisation.

ONLINE SPECTROMETER

The OIW EX 1000 has an inbuilt optical spectrum analyser that allows for enhanced analysis of produced water. The online spectrometer offers a new standard of analysis in produced water monitoring.

The OIW EX1000 is also able to detect other abnormalities in the water. "We can see if there's an anomaly in what the unit is measuring by looking at the UV spectrum," said Thabeth, "this allows the instrument to detect chemical additives present in the process."

DETAILED ANALYSIS OF PRODUCED WATER

This market first offers information that was previously thought unattainable, empowering process engineers with a far greater insight of process dynamics resulting in even greater process management. Where detailed analysis of boiler feed water or heat exchanger mediums are necessary for process efficiency, the on-line spectrometer can detect chemical anomalies in the sample stream. Conversely, it is also possible to differentiate between normally present process chemicals and hydrocarbons in the produced water discharge.

The operating system is built on the globally recognised Windows operating system, offering a familiar environment and making operation of the instrument self-intuitive. The flexibility of Windows XP gives the analyser more software intelligence for calibration, diagnostics, detailed analysis and communications.

Data logging is fitted as standard in all OIW EX 100/1000 series analysers with a ten-year storage capacity. Software included helps users interrogate the detailed data, remotely or at the point of installation.
